Do we have Teradata TTU package which we can install on Amazon EMR?We need only the Teradata TTU package suite and not the database itself.Do we need to buy it from AWS marketplace?
Not sure if this helps you or not, but if you deploy a Teradata Database on AWS, then under the directory /var/opt/teradata/TTU_pkgs
Yyu should see the following packages (your versions may be different than mine). So there are Windows, Linux and Mac OS Client packages available.
SMP001-01:/var/opt/teradata/TTU_pkgs # ls -l
-rwx------ 1 ec2-user ec2-user 221043137 Dec 21 16:57 DatabaseManagement__windows_i386-x86184.108.40.206.00.zip
-rwx------ 1 ec2-user ec2-user 102429801 Dec 21 17:30 TeradataToolsAndUtilitiesBase__Linux_i386-x86220.127.116.11.00.tar.gz
-rwx------ 1 ec2-user ec2-user 37156769 Dec 21 17:29 TeradataToolsAndUtilitiesBase__MACOSX_x8618.104.22.168.00.tar.gz
-rwx------ 1 ec2-user ec2-user 390724487 Dec 21 17:31 TeradataToolsAndUtilitiesBase__windows_i386-x8622.214.171.124.00.zip
As long as you have Teradata deployed on some AWS server you should be able to copy those client packages to another server to be able to use to connect to your Teradata AWS image. So for example you could log into your Teradata AWS image then transfer the Linux Client packages to a non-Teradata Suse Linux server that you want to use to run client utilities from and connect to your Teradata server from the non-Teradata server. Hope that helps.
TTU does not support running on an EMR cluster.
But I would like to understand your use-case.
1. Is the data you are trying to query from EMR on S3 and accessed via EMFRS ? Or is the data on HDFS ?
2. Can you add more details on your use case for TTU on EMR ?
We have the data on Teradata instance running in AWS single node cluster.The TTU(FastExport) has to be run on an AWS EMR cluster which will fetch the data from the stanalone Teradata DataBase Server and export it in the EMR AWS instance.So my guess would be the TTU utility should be present in the EMR of AWS.
This is ceratinly a very intersting use-case.
We will investigate internally about potentially evaluating this for the future.